Wilson Meyer Rehrig 67,220,480
General Notes: Wilson prepared for college at the Lehighton Academy and graduated from Muhlenberg College in 1879. Entering the Lutheran Theological Seminary at Philadelphia, he completed his course in 1882, being ordained as a minister of the Lutheran Church in June of the same year. Immediately after his ordination he located in Girardville where he organized a mission. Upon his resignation in 1887 he had gathered a self-sustaining congregation of more than three hundred members. He assumed charge of a country parish at Greenville, Mercer Co. Later he became pastor of the Church of Thiel College where he was acting German professor of the college besides being an instructor in various other subjects. Wilson married Margaret M English on Feb 26, 1884. (Margaret M English was born on an unknown date and died on an unknown date.) |
